  1. Marabouts et Khouan. Etude sur l'Islam en Algérie. Avec une carte indiquant la marche, la situation et l'importance des ordres religieux musulmansMarabouts et Khouan. Etude sur l'Islam en Algérie. Avec une carte indiquant la marche, la situation et l'importance des ordres religieux musulmans
    Louis-Marie RINN

    Marabouts et Khouan. Etude sur l'Islam en Algérie. Avec une carte indiquant la marche, la situation et l'importance des ordres religieux musulmans[Marabouts and Khouan. A Study of Islam in Algeria. With a Map Indicating the Spread, Situation, and Importance of the Muslim Religious Orders]

    Adolphe JOURDAN • Challamel|Algiers • Paris 1884|16.8 x 25.8 cm|Relié

    First edition, illustrated at the end of the volume with three folding maps (cf. Tailliart 3080; Playfair 4334).

    The original colour map, frequently lacking, has here been supplied in photomechanical reproduction, while the two others are later insertions.

    Full brick-coloured sheep binding, unlettered spine with five raised bands showing traces of rubbing, comb-marbled endpapers and pastedowns, original wrappers preserved; modern binding.

    Minor foxing, pencil annotations on the initial endpapers and in the margins of several passages, with a handwritten note in blue ink "états de service" at the head of the front endpaper, followed by a brief pencilled biography...

  2. Fine Album of Naval Lithographs
    Fine Album of Naval Lithographs
    [MARINE] La marine française de nos jours. Cuirassés-Croiseurs-Transports-Torpilleurs. Types principaux de la marine marchande[MARINE] La marine française de nos jours. Cuirassés-Croiseurs-Transports-Torpilleurs. Types principaux de la marine marchande
    COLLECTIF

    [MARINE] La marine française de nos jours. Cuirassés-Croiseurs-Transports-Torpilleurs. Types principaux de la marine marchandeThe French Navy Today. Battleships – Cruisers – Transports – Torpedo Boats. Principal Types of the Merchant Marine

    Challamel|Paris s. d. [1890]|35.8 x 27.7 cm|Reliure de l'éditeur

    Album of 50 full-page plates signed by Lange, each with captioned tissue guards (cf. Polak 6415).

    Publisher's binding in red half shagreen, spine with five raised bands decorated with gilt dotted rolls and black fillets, gilt naval anchors, gilt title and naval anchor on the upper cover in red cloth, marbled endpapers and pastedowns.

    Some minor foxing, a few faded spots along the edges of the covers, a well-preserved copy overall.

    A fine visual survey of the French navy at the end of the 19th century, featuring 44 warships and 6 merchant vessels (from the Compagnie Générale Transatlantique, Messageries Maritimes, Chargeurs Réunis, Albert Méniér, and...

  4. Mission Chari - Lac Tchad 1902-1904. L'Afrique Centrale Française. Récit du voyage de la mission. Appendice par MM. Pellegrin, Germain, Courtet, Petit, Bouvier, Lesnes, Du Buysson, SurcoufMission Chari - Lac Tchad 1902-1904. L'Afrique Centrale Française. Récit du voyage de la mission. Appendice par MM. Pellegrin, Germain, Courtet, Petit, Bouvier, Lesnes, Du Buysson, Surcouf
    Auguste CHEVALIER

    Mission Chari - Lac Tchad 1902-1904. L'Afrique Centrale Française. Récit du voyage de la mission. Appendice par MM. Pellegrin, Germain, Courtet, Petit, Bouvier, Lesnes, Du Buysson, Surcouf

    Challamel|Paris 1907 (1908 sur la couverture)|19.2 x 28.2 cm|Relié

    First edition, illustrated with a frontispiece, 6 folding maps, 24 plates out of text, and 95 in-text reproductions.

    Bradel binding in full blue cloth, cherry shagreen title label, original wrappers and spine preserved.

    The botanist and biologist Auguste Chevalier (1873–1956) undertook numerous expeditions to Africa, Asia, and South America after earning his doctorate in 1901.

    A handsome copy.

    Inscribed and signed by Auguste-Jean-Baptiste Chevalier to Madame P. Lemoine at the head of the title page.
